PPC (Pay-per-click) Advertising Platforms



🔍 1. Google Ads – Most Popular PPC Platform


  • Covers: Search, Display, YouTube, Shopping

  • Massive reach, advanced targeting, smart bidding

  • Ideal for: eCommerce, SaaS, local services


---


📘 2. Meta Ads (Facebook & Instagram) – Best for Social Reach


  • Visual ads with granular audience targeting

  • Perfect for brand awareness + performance


---


🔎 3. Microsoft Advertising (Bing Ads) – Search Alternative to Google


  • Lower CPCs, older & high-income audiences

  • Syncs with Google Ads easily


---


🛒 4. Amazon Ads – Best for Product-Based Businesses


  • Sponsored products, brands, and display

  • Purchase-ready intent = high ROI


---


👔 5. LinkedIn Ads – Best B2B PPC Channel


  • Job titles, industries, company targeting

  • Higher CPC, but super-qualified leads


---


🐦 6. Twitter Ads – Best for Real-Time Engagement


  • Promote tweets, trends, and accounts

  • Niche but powerful for news or event-based brands


---


🎵 7. TikTok Ads – Top for Gen Z Attention


  • Vertical video ads with high engagement

  • Creative-driven PPC campaigns


---


👻 8. Snapchat Ads – Youth-Focused Visual Ads


  • AR lenses, story ads, and filters

  • Lower CPMs for Gen Z reach


---


📌 9. Pinterest Ads – Great for Lifestyle & Shopping Brands


  • Product pins, idea ads

  • Strong female audience & high purchase intent


---


❓ 10. Quora Ads – Intent-Based Content PPC


  • Text + display ads targeting questions & interests

  • Underrated for SaaS, education, and thought leadership


---


🧠 11. Reddit Ads – Community-Driven Paid Ads


  • Contextual targeting within subreddits

  • Great for niche audiences, startups


---


🎧 12. Spotify Ads – Audio-Based PPC Advertising


  • Audio + video ads for music listeners

  • Great for brand storytelling


---



🔁 13. AdRoll – Best for Retargeting & Cross-Channel Ads


  • Display + email + social remarketing

  • Works across platforms like Google & Meta


---


📢 14. Outbrain – Top Native Ad Platform


  • Sponsored content on premium publishers

  • High CTRs in news & lifestyle niches


---


📊 15. Taboola – Content Discovery & Native Ads


  • Competes with Outbrain

  • Ideal for blogs, lead gen, and affiliate marketers


---


🛍 16. Criteo – AI-Powered Dynamic Retargeting


  • Focused on eCommerce & product feed ads

  • Real-time personalization


---


🇷🇺 17. Yandex.Direct – Top PPC Platform in Russia


  • Russian-language search & display ads

  • Local targeting for Eastern Europe


---


🇨🇳 18. Baidu Ads – Dominant Chinese PPC Platform


  • Chinese search engine ads + native content

  • Key for entering the China market


---


🚀 19. PropellerAds – Performance-Driven Ad Network


  • Push, popunder, native, and interstitial ads

  • Affordable CPCs, global traffic


---


📰 20. Yahoo Native Ads – Legacy Native PPC Network


  • Ads across Yahoo, AOL, and news partners

  • Still relevant for display & native ad buyers


---


🍏 21. Apple Search Ads – Top for iOS App Install Campaigns


  • Search ads within the App Store

  • Low-funnel traffic, premium audience


---


🧠 22. Media.net – Contextual Ads Powered by Yahoo-Bing


  • Great AdSense alternative

  • Text & display ads for content websites




Frequently Asked Questions on the Best PPC Advertising Platforms



Which PPC platforms have the lowest CPC (cost-per-click)?


It depends on your niche and targeting, but platforms like:

  • Microsoft Ads (Bing) – often has cheaper CPCs than Google

  • Pinterest Ads – cost-effective for lifestyle and product niches

  • Reddit Ads & Quora Ads – good for niche audiences with less competition

  • PropellerAds – lower-cost CPC for display, push, and popunder traffic




What’s the difference between Search, Social, and native PPC platforms?


  • Search PPC: Ads triggered by keywords (e.g., Google Ads, Bing Ads)

  • Social PPC: Ads shown on social feeds (e.g., Meta Ads, TikTok Ads)

  • Native PPC: Ads that blend with content (e.g., Outbrain, Taboola)


Each type serves a different user intent and ad format—search is high intent, social is discovery-based, and native is content-driven.




Can I run PPC ads on multiple channels at the same time?


Absolutely. Most advertisers diversify across several PPC platforms to reach different audiences and reduce risk. For example:

  • Use Google Ads for high-intent search traffic

  • Combine with Meta Ads for remarketing and awareness

  • Layer in LinkedIn Ads for B2B or Amazon Ads for product listings


Make sure to align messaging and track ROAS (Return on Ad Spend) per channel.




Which PPC ad network is best for B2B marketing?


  • LinkedIn Ads – unmatched for targeting professionals by job title, industry, and company

  • Google Search – capture high-intent B2B keywords

  • Quora Ads – excellent for thought leadership, software, and educational offers

  • Microsoft Ads – similar to Google but less competitive


These platforms work well for lead generation, webinars, software trials, and other B2B funnel objectives.




How do I choose the best PPC advertising channel for my business?


Start by aligning your business goals with the platform’s strengths:


  • For high-intent search traffic, go with Google Ads or Microsoft Ads

  • For visual storytelling or brand engagement, try Meta, TikTok, or Snapchat Ads

  • For eCommerce, use Amazon Ads, Pinterest Ads, or Criteo

  • For B2B lead generation, prioritize LinkedIn Ads and Quora Ads

  • For retargeting, platforms like AdRoll, Meta, and Google Display Network excel


Also consider your budget, audience location, ad formats, and the CPC or CPM rates of each network.
